Antichat снова доступен.
Форум Antichat (Античат) возвращается и снова открыт для пользователей.
Здесь обсуждаются безопасность, программирование, технологии и многое другое.
Сообщество снова собирается вместе.
Новый адрес: forum.antichat.xyz
 |
|
как сжать basa.sql в basa.gz |

18.11.2007, 17:37
|
|
Участник форума
Регистрация: 28.07.2007
Сообщений: 177
Провел на форуме: 274360
Репутация:
5
|
|
как сжать basa.sql в basa.gz
с помощью какой проги можно осушесвить?:
|
|
|

18.11.2007, 17:49
|
|
Moderator - Level 7
Регистрация: 24.02.2006
Сообщений: 447
Провел на форуме: 2872049
Репутация:
705
|
|
из базы можно сжать с помощью дампера dumper http://sypex.net/
|
|
|

18.11.2007, 17:49
|
|
Познавший АНТИЧАТ
Регистрация: 09.06.2006
Сообщений: 1,359
Провел на форуме: 5301021
Репутация:
1879
|
|
man gzip
man tar
:
_http://www.opennet.ru/man.shtml?topic=gzip&category=1
_http://www.opennet.ru/man.shtml?topic=tar&category=1
Иль скриптом(если установлен модуль)
PHP код:
<?php
$level=15;
$dest=$file.'.gz';
$mode='wb'.$level;
if($fp_out=gzopen($dest,$mode)){
if($fp_in=fopen($file,'rb')){
while(!feof($fp_in))
gzputs($fp_out,fread($fp_in,1024*512));
fclose($fp_in);
}
gzclose($fp_out);
}
@unlink("$file");
}
Если я правильно понял...
Последний раз редактировалось Dr.Check; 18.11.2007 в 18:19..
|
|
|

18.11.2007, 19:31
|
|
Участник форума
Регистрация: 28.07.2007
Сообщений: 177
Провел на форуме: 274360
Репутация:
5
|
|
неее нето...есть на компе файлик ..база данных..на 100 метров.. lotokcom_2006-11-29_02-45.sql ...а мне надо его в базу данных загнать черех майскладмин..атам ограничение стоит на 20 метров .. и хз как его туда загнать..
или хотяю мне на компе ет дело открыть ...и почистить табличку от юзеров там и прочех хни..как ет сделать?
|
|
|

18.11.2007, 21:34
|
|
Друг Клитора
Регистрация: 27.08.2005
Сообщений: 1,662
Провел на форуме: 6913553
Репутация:
1329
|
|
Так велич ограничение в php.ini
upload_max_filesize = 200M
А вот и Сжатие
Код:
<?php
$data = implode("", file("bigfile.txt"));
$gzdata = gzencode($data, 9);
$fp = fopen("bigfile.txt.gz", "w");
fwrite($fp, $gzdata);
fclose($fp);
?>
|
|
|

18.11.2007, 21:44
|
|
Участник форума
Регистрация: 28.07.2007
Сообщений: 177
Провел на форуме: 274360
Репутация:
5
|
|
Сообщение от limpompo
Так велич ограничение в php.ini
upload_max_filesize = 200M
А вот и Сжатие
Код:
<?php
$data = implode("", file("bigfile.txt"));
$gzdata = gzencode($data, 9);
$fp = fopen("bigfile.txt.gz", "w");
fwrite($fp, $gzdata);
fclose($fp);
?>
а где ж мне етот php.ini найти?
|
|
|

18.11.2007, 21:46
|
|
Постоянный
Регистрация: 11.11.2006
Сообщений: 595
Провел на форуме: 1845062
Репутация:
1079
|
|
Сообщение от ufalog
а где ж мне етот php.ini найти?
/etc/php.ini
|
|
|

18.11.2007, 23:33
|
|
Друг Клитора
Регистрация: 27.08.2005
Сообщений: 1,662
Провел на форуме: 6913553
Репутация:
1329
|
|
Если никс тогда
locate php.ini
или find / -name php.ini
|
|
|

19.11.2007, 00:45
|
|
♠ ♦ ♣ ♥
Регистрация: 18.05.2006
Сообщений: 1,828
Провел на форуме: 8042357
Репутация:
3742
|
|
1) разбей бд по таблам и и проинзерть отедльно
или
2) заархивь и на серваке разархивируй
или
3) лей рст скл (или если есть пхп майадмин), создавай базу, и там открывай выполнить скл запрос.. и копируй туда весь дамп -))
__________________
Привет! Меня зовут Джордж, и я хотел бы рассказать вам про реинкарнацию (ц) 2x2
|
|
|

19.11.2007, 00:53
|
|
Познавший АНТИЧАТ
Регистрация: 21.11.2004
Сообщений: 1,137
Провел на форуме: 2487541
Репутация:
761
|
|
Код:
mysqldump -u user --pasword=123 mybase > base.sql
tar -czf base.tgz base.sql
что-то вроде этого заархивирует дамп. А загнать в базу еще проще
Код:
cat base.sql | mysql -u user --password=123 mybase
Заганять через phpmyadmin - дело не благодарное. Вдруг сорвётся что. Так-что лучше вначале залить на сервер, а там уж засовывать в базу 
|
|
|
|
 |
|
|
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
|
|
|
|